summarylogtreecommitdiffstats
path: root/patch_makefile
blob: 58fcaa7314b6bc5d448ca11e0e13d6f091fee43c (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
diff --git a/QDMA/linux-kernel/Makefile b/QDMA/linux-kernel/Makefile
index 08340f6..889ceb9 100755
--- a/QDMA/linux-kernel/Makefile
+++ b/QDMA/linux-kernel/Makefile
@@ -116,11 +116,9 @@ clean:
 
 .PHONY: install-mods
 install-mods:
-	@echo "installing kernel modules to /lib/modules/$(shell uname -r)/qdma ..."
-	@mkdir -p -m 755 /lib/modules/$(shell uname -r)/qdma
-	@install -v -m 644 $(bin_dir)/*.ko /lib/modules/$(shell uname -r)/qdma
-	@depmod -a || true
-
+	@echo "installing kernel modules to $(kernel_install_path) ..."
+	@mkdir -p -m 755 $(kernel_install_path)
+	@install -v -m 755 $(bin_dir)/*.ko $(kernel_install_path)
 
 .PHONY: install-apps
 install-apps:
@@ -144,8 +142,8 @@ install-dev:
 
 .PHONY: uninstall-mods
 uninstall-mods:
-	@echo "Un-installing /lib/modules/$(shell uname -r)/qdma ..."
-	@/bin/rm -rf /lib/modules/$(shell uname -r)/qdma
+	@echo "Un-installing $(kernel_install_path) ..."
+	@/bin/rm -rf $(kernel_install_path)
 	@depmod -a
 
 .PHONY: uninstall-apps